Web15 Nov 2005 · setbuf() has to do with the delivery of bytes between the C library FILE* management layer and the OS I/O layer. Calls to fread(), fgets(), fgetc(), and getchar() work within whatever FILE* buffered data is available, and when that data is exhausted, the calls request that the FILE* buffer be refilled by the system I/O layer. Webstd::setvbuf should also be used to detect errors, since std::setbuf does not indicate success or failure. This function may only be used after stream has been associated with an open …
C setbuf() function
Web11 Mar 2024 · The Linux Kernel Documentation 有相关的介绍. The FS segment is commonly used to address Thread Local Storage (TLS). FS is usually managed by runtime code or a threading library. Variables declared with the ‘__thread’ storage class specifier are instantiated per thread and the compiler emits the FS: address prefix for accesses to … WebThe setbuffer () function is the same, except that the size of the buffer is up to the caller, rather than being determined by the default BUFSIZ. The setlinebuf () function is exactly equivalent to the call: setvbuf (stream, NULL, _IOLBF, 0); Return Value The function setvbuf () returns 0 on success. 勉強 難しい 眠くなる
putenv(3) - Linux manual page - Michael Kerrisk
WebC Language: setbuf function (Set Buffer) In the C Programming Language, the setbuf function lets you change the way a stream is buffered and to control the size and location … WebThe C programming language provides many standard library functions for file input and output.These functions make up the bulk of the C standard library header . The functionality descends from a "portable I/O package" written by Mike Lesk at Bell Labs in the early 1970s, and officially became part of the Unix operating system in Version 7.. The I/O … Web20 Sep 2024 · C library function - setbuf () The setbuf () function controls buffering for the specified stream if the operating system supports user-defined buffers. The stream pointer must refer to an open file before any I/O or repositioning has been done. Syntax: void setbuf (FILE *stream, char *buffer) setbuf () Parameters: Return value from setbuf () av5000シリーズ ベックマン・コールター